October 2014 ArtRage Events

Gifford “What If…” film – I Learn America
Tuesday, October 7, 2014    6:30 – 8:30 pm
doors open at 6:00 for light snacks
Free to the Public

 

Gifford “What If…” film –
I Learn America

Directed by Jean-Michel Dissard & Gitte Peng(52min)
ArtRage Gallery, 505 Hawley Avenue @ N. Crouse, Syracuse   315-218-5711   www.artragegallery.org 

The children of immigration, here to stay, are the new Americans. How we fare in welcoming them will determine the nature of this country in the 21st century and beyond. In “I Learn America,” five resilient immigrant teenagers come together over a year at the NYC International High School at Lafayette, and struggle to learn their new land. Through these five vibrant young people, their stories and struggles, and their willingness to open their lives and share them with us, we “learn America.” Watch the trailer at http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=qbW4gytQCiE&feature=youtu.be

Artist Talk with Ben Altman & Paul Pearce

ArtRage Gallery, 505 Hawley Avenue @ N. Crouse, Syracuse   315-218-5711   www.artragegallery.org 
Join us for an Artist Talk featuring two CNY artists, Ben Altman of Ithaca, NY and Paul Pearce from Syracuse, NY. Both artists are featured in the current ArtRage exhibition, GLOBALissues.CLIMATEmatters.socialCHANGE. More info at http://artragegallery.org/artist-talk-with-ben-altman-paul-pearce

CNY-Cajibio Sister Community Delegation Report

ArtRage Gallery, 505 Hawley Avenue @ N. Crouse, Syracuse   315-218-5711   www.artragegallery.org 

Join the Central New York Cajibio Sister Community as they report back on their trip to Colombia. Frank Cetera and Emily Coralyne will share their stories and reflect on
their ideas of international solidarity. The Sister Community will also be presenting a film that demonstrates the experiences and struggles of families who have lost loved ones due to
paramilitary violence in the Cauca region of Colombia.

Israel v. Israel ~ A film about Israeli Peace Activists

ArtRage Gallery, 505 Hawley Avenue @ N. Crouse, Syracuse   315-218-5711   www.artragegallery.org 

An  Al Jazeera Documentary by Terje Carlesson,  focusing on  Jewish Peace Activists who face skepticism and criticism from their fellow Israeli citizens.  They are a Rabbi, a soldier,
a grandmother and an anarchist – who share a common goal: to achieve peace in the Middle East and end the Israeli occupation of the Palestinian Territories. Sponsored by Working for a Just Peace in Israel & Palestine, a project of the Syracuse Peace Council.

“La Camioneta” film screening with Engineers Without Borders

ArtRage Gallery, 505 Hawley Avenue @ N. Crouse, Syracuse   315-218-5711   www.artragegallery.org 

Engineers Without Borders Syracuse Professionals is showing the multi-award-winning documentary film, “La Camioneta” as a fundraiser for their sanitation project in the rural community of Las Majadas, Guatemala. LA CAMIONETA follows the journey of a decommissioned American school bus on its transformative journey to Guatemala: a journey between North and South, between life and death, and through an unfolding collection of moments, people, and places that serve to quietly remind us of the interconnected worlds in which we live.

Ivy (1947)

Directed by Sam Wood with Joan Fontaine

ArtRage Gallery, 505 Hawley Avenue @ N. Crouse, Syracuse   315-218-5711   www.artragegallery.org 

Directed by Sam Wood with Joan Fontaine. Ivy.pity the men in her life!  In this Gothic/Film Noir hybrid, Ivy spells chills as a reckless Edwardian beauty with a poisonous hunger for seduction and wealth.  Dazzlingly shot and costumed gaslight melodrama with a “tour de force performance” (NY Times) by its Oscar-winning star.  A forgotten film gem, and Cannes Film Festival entry.

Bram Stoker’s Dracula (1992)

Directed by Francis Ford Coppola with Gary Oldman, Winona Ryder, Anthony Hopkins, Keanu Reeves

ArtRage Gallery, 505 Hawley Avenue @ N. Crouse, Syracuse   315-218-5711   www.artragegallery.org 
Celebrate Halloween with a sumptuous take on the king of vampires that’s unlike all earlier pop culture versions. Be prepared: this Dracula wants more than bloodlust; it’s love he’s after! A stylish, sexy, over-the-top, gorgeously gory epic that lights up the prince of darkness with a shadowy mix of beauty, horror.and terrific performances.
